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18403 8516196 547213
0498110683 768
0498110683 768
44726600 99124 01845
All about undefined
Interested in learning more?
0498110683 768
44726600 99124 01845
See more
8302598417 78236648666
1041 82 8208
See more
94639 67983520112 82928
05694521 13493026044 64582 55 32734021
See more